Making smallholder farmers more secure: ICRISAT’s contribution to climate research
- From
-
Published on
11.12.18
- Impact Area
As nations from around the globe debate the impacts of climate change and discuss sustainable solutions to mitigating them at COP24, we take a look at just a few of ICRISAT’s recent initiatives that helped alleviate some challenges from changing climate worldwide, especially in the drylands
